2.         Work

2.1             Due to the nature of our Services it is difficult to determine an exact estimation as often there can be unforeseen                             works found that we cannot initially account for. Any estimate given is for guidance based upon our experience and                         should not be used as a definitive budget. Providing our Services is a complex operation where the condition of the                         base vehicle can only be assessed when completely stripped. Many components that may have appeared to be                             serviceable may need replacing along the course of the restoration thus rendering any estimate null and void.

2.2             Any additional Work requested by the customer during or on completion of the restoration that is not included in the                       original estimate will be subject to charge.

2.3             Any deposit required as part of a payment schedule must be paid prior to work being undertaken on any vehicle.

2.4             During the lifetime of the project, staged payments may be requested. Failure to meet these payments may result in                       the project being halted.

2.5             We will review our rates annually. If our hourly rates change, we will notify you in writing of the new rates and from                           what date the new rates will apply.

2.6             Our Services are often a timely process and JSC AUTOMOTIVE Ltd will not compromise timescales whereby the                           quality or standard of work are affected.

2.7             It is strict company policy that once all works have been completed and before the vehicle leaves the premises, any                       amounts outstanding are to be settled in full.

 

3.         Payment and Invoices

3.1             If we require a deposit or similar prepayment, we shall state it clearly in the Estimate and you must pay this within 7                       days, or to the agreed schedule;

3.2             From the point at which Work on the Vehicle commences up until the point at which you have paid in full all sums due,                   we shall have a general lien on your Vehicle (i.e. a right to possession of property until payment is made for work done                   to that property) for all sums due;

3.3             Following our completion of the Work, we shall issue an invoice to you or we may issue interim invoices for extensive                     Work. This will be made clear in our Estimate;

3.4             The invoice(s) will provide a summary of all Work done and will provide details of all parts and labour including the                         Price payable for it with the VAT element payable on it shown separately;

3.5             All sums due will be payable within 7 days of the invoice date or, by cleared funds, prior to the release of the vehicle or                   goods which ever falls first;

3.6             In addition to our rights under sub-Clause 3.2, JSC AUTOMOTIVE Ltd will charge a monthly storage charge for any                       vehicle or parts thereof belonging to a customer with invoices pertaining to that vehicle or parts thereof that are                               outstanding over 30 days. If invoices have not been settled within 6 months and no attempt has been made to settle                       the account then JSC AUTOMOTIVE Ltd reserve the right to sell your vehicle or any items similar in value at your                           expense to the outstanding invoice and/or the storage charge.

                  If, after a six month period of time has elapsed without the owner making contact JSC AUTOMOTIVE Ltd and                                 reasonable attempts made to contact the owner, then JSC AUTOMOTIVE Ltd shall take steps to remove the vehicle                       and recover losses without further reference.

3.7             From the due date of payment until we take the action set out in sub-Clause 3.6, any outstanding sum will incur                               interest on a daily basis at 4% above the base rate of the Bank of England until you make payment in full.

3.8             Where you are a Company, should you fail to make payment to us of any amount due, we reserve the right to charge                     you interest and administration costs of recovery in accordance with the Late Payment of Commercial Debts (Interest)                   Act 1998 (as amended).
